Batesville Man Arrested in Oxford for Possession of a Weapon by a Felon

On July 25, 2022, an officer with the Oxford Police Department initiated a traffic stop on Jackson Avenue for no seatbelt and an expired vehicle tag.

After investigation, Henry James Patterson, 33, of Batesville, Mississippi, was arrested and charged with Possession of a Weapon by a Felon.  

Patterson was taken before a Lafayette County Justice Court judge for his initial bond hearing and  issued a $5,000 bond.

The Oxford Police Department is housed 715 Molly Barr Road. The department has more than 70 full-time officers and staff and provides a wide range of protection and enforcement services. The Police Department has a community-oriented policing philosophy and provides around-the-clock patrols. Other services include crime prevention programs, such as Neighborhood Watch and D.A.R.E., as well as specialized units including Mounted Patrol, K-9 Unit, DUI Enforcement and the City Dispatch.
